[PATCH v3 2/3] random: convert to using fops->write_iter()

From: Jason A. Donenfeld
Date: Thu May 19 2022 - 20:41:29 EST


From: Jens Axboe <axboe@xxxxxxxxx>

Now that the read side has been converted to fix a regression with
splice, convert the write side as well to have some symmetry in the
interface used (and help deprecate ->write()).

Signed-off-by: Jens Axboe <axboe@xxxxxxxxx>
[Jason: cleaned up random_ioctl a bit, require full writes in
RNDADDENTROPY since it's crediting entropy, and minimize control flow of
write_pool().]
Signed-off-by: Jason A. Donenfeld <Jason@xxxxxxxxx>
---
drivers/char/random.c | 68 +++++++++++++++++++++++--------------------
1 file changed, 36 insertions(+), 32 deletions(-)
